gpt4 book ai didi

rubygems - cocoaPods pod install 权限被拒绝

转载 作者:行者123 更新时间:2023-12-03 06:01:03 26 4
gpt4 key购买 nike

这是简短版本:

当我运行时

pod install 

在 Xcode 项目中我得到

[!] Pod::Executable pull error: cannot open .git/FETCH_HEAD: Permission denied

如果我运行

sudo pod install

我没有收到错误,但我安装的文件归 root 所有,无法编译,我必须将这些文件 chown 给普通用户才能使用 Xcode 编译器。

我正在运行 Lion OSX。

我使用安装了 cocoaPods

sudo gem install cocoaPods

我必须使用sudo,因为没有它我就得到了

ERROR: While executing gem ... (Gem::FilePermissionError)

You don't have write permissions into the /Library/Ruby/Gems/1.8 directory.

现在我有一个 root 安装版本的 cocoaPods,可以下载 root 拥有的 Xcode 库。

sudo安装cocoaPods是错误的方式还是正常的方式?

如果正常,有办法解决pod安装问题吗?

最佳答案

我通过运行以下命令解决了这个问题:

sudo chown -R $USER ~/Library/Caches/CocoaPods

sudo chown -R $USER ~/.cocoapods

请将用户名组名替换为您的Mac登录用户名/组名。

关于rubygems - cocoaPods pod install 权限被拒绝,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16049335/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com